简单计算器模拟:输入两个整数和一个运算符,输出运算结果。
输入格式:
第一行输入两个整数,用空格分开;
第二行输入一个运算符(+、-、*、/)。
所有运算均为整数运算,保证除数不包含0。
输出格式:
输出对两个数运算后的结果。
输入样例:
30 50
*
输出样例:
1500
代码长度限制
16 KB
时间限制
400 ms
内存限制
64 MB
思路:
输入时注意第一行输入两个整数,第二行输入运算符。本题实现一个简单的四则运算,并且在做除法运算时要对除数做判断,除数不能为0。
代码:
#include<stdio.h>
int main( )
{
int a,b;
char c;
scanf("%d%d\n%c",&a,&b,&c);
switch(c)
{
case '+':printf("%d",a+b);
break;
case '-':printf("%d",a-b);
break;
case '*':printf("%d",a*b);
break;
case '/':
if(b!=0)
{
printf("%d",a/b);
break;
}
}
}